Canada - DuPont Pioneer announces winners of the 2017 Seed for Season Maritimes Contest
Mississauga, Ontario, Canada
February 13, 2017
DuPont Pioneer today announced the winners of its Seed for a Season contest in the Maritime provinces. This contest provides opportunities to DuPont Pioneer customers to improve the profitability of their operations and features three prizes of up to $10,000 in Pioneer® brand seed products.
“We are happy to announce our Seed for a Season Maritimes contest winners in Nova Scotia, New Brunswick, and Prince Edward Island,” says Collin Phillip, business director - Eastern Canada, DuPont Pioneer. “It is an opportunity to help these customers pursue a project or dream by providing their seed for the coming season."

DuPont Pioneer customers entered the Seed for a Season Maritimes contest by purchasing any Pioneer brand corn or soybean products by December 9, 2016 and were automatically entered for a chance to win one of three prizes. One winner was chosen in each of Nova Scotia, New Brunswick, and Prince Edward Island.
